在网站设计中,用户登录后的默认跳转页面对于用户体验至关重要。当用户通过QQ登录成功后,默认回调至首页而不是个人中心页面,往往会造成用户的不便和困惑。本文将详细介绍如何解决这一问题,实现登录后直接跳转至个人中心页面的功能。
问题分析
1. 需求理解:用户期望在QQ登录成功后,能够直接跳转至个人中心页面,以便于查看个人信息和进行相关操作。
2. 技术难点:实现这一功能需要网站后端与QQ登录接口进行联动,确保在用户登录成功后,能够准确识别并执行跳转操作。
解决方案
1. 后端开发:在网站后端开发中,需要与QQ登录接口进行对接。当用户通过QQ成功登录后,后端服务器会接收到登录成功的通知。此时,服务器需要判断用户的登录状态,并执行相应的跳转操作。
2. 跳转逻辑:在服务器端编写逻辑代码,当检测到用户登录成功后,通过服务器端语言(如PHP、Python等)向前端发送跳转指令。前端接收到指令后,执行跳转操作,将用户引导至个人中心页面。
3. 页面设计:个人中心页面需要具备简洁、明了的设计风格,以便用户快速找到所需功能。页面应提供个人信息、账户设置、历史记录等常用功能,满足用户的日常需求。
实施步骤
1. 联系QQ开放平台:与QQ开放平台联系,获取API接口和权限,以便实现QQ登录功能。
2. 后端开发:开发人员根据需求进行后端开发,实现与QQ登录接口的对接。
3. 前端开发:开发人员编写前端代码,确保页面能够正确接收后端发送的跳转指令。
4. 测试:对网站进行全面测试,确保QQ登录及跳转功能正常。
5. 上线:将网站部署至服务器,供用户使用。
注意事项
1. 安全性:在开发过程中,应确保网站的安全性,防止恶意攻击和用户信息泄露。
2. 兼容性:考虑不同浏览器和设备的兼容性,确保用户在不同环境下都能正常使用网站功能。
3. 用户体验:优化网站设计和功能布局,提高用户体验,减少用户操作步骤和时间。
通过以上步骤,我们可以实现网站QQ登录后默认跳转至个人中心页面的功能。这一改进措施能够提高用户体验,减少用户操作步骤和时间。在实施过程中,我们需要关注安全性、兼容性和用户体验等方面,确保网站的稳定运行和用户的满意程度。